Exploring the Role of CAM in Lymphatic Health and Detoxification

Complementary and alternative medicine (CAM) is gaining recognition for its potential advantages in promoting overall well-being. A growing body of research suggests that certain CAM practices may play a role in supporting lymphatic health and detoxification processes within the body. The lymphatic system, an intricate network of vessels and nodes, serves as a crucial component of the immune system, filtering waste products, carrying fluids, and fighting infections.

Several CAM modalities have been investigated for their potential to enhance lymphatic function. Lymph drainage massage, a gentle method that stimulates lymph flow, is one such practice. It involves using specific hand movements to encourage the movement of lymph fluid through the body, potentially aiding in the removal of toxins and waste products.

Additionally, botanical remedies have been traditionally used to support lymphatic health. Certain herbs possess anti-inflammatory properties and may help to reduce swelling and congestion within the lymphatic system. However, it is essential to consult with a qualified healthcare practitioner before using any herbal supplements, as they can interact with medications or have potential side effects.

Furthermore, practices such as acupuncture and yoga have also been linked with improvements in lymphatic function. Acupuncture, which involves inserting thin needles into specific points on the body, may stimulate lymph flow and promote detoxification. Yoga's combination of stretching, breathing exercises, and mindfulness can help to reduce stress and improve overall circulation, indirectly supporting lymphatic health.

While CAM practices show promise for enhancing lymphatic health and detoxification, it is important to note that research in this area is still evolving. It is always best to consult with a healthcare professional to determine the most appropriate treatment plan based on individual needs and medical history.
